What does wayworn mean?
Wayworn means Weary from travelling..
Checking saved dictionary data and trusted language sources. This will stop automatically if a source does not respond.
/ˈweɪ.wɔːn/ · adjective
Weary from travelling..
She was soon followed by Glentworth, who stepped slowly and anxiously towards the dressing-room, and, ere he reached it, heard, with a delight the wayworn traveller and anxious husband alone can know, Isabella's cry of joy,...
